CONTINGENCY PLAN USE <br /> In the event of an emergency, the contingency plan is implemented by : <br /> • Calling the Fire Department <br /> • Containing and cleaning up small spills and releases if possible <br /> • Contacting a private cleanup contractor to contain and cleanup large <br /> spills and releases <br /> 6. 3 . EMERGENCY COMMUNICATIONS <br /> If only one employee is on the premises while the facility is operating, <br /> he/ she must have immediate access to emergency communications <br /> equipment, such as a telephone or a hand-held two-way radio, capable of <br /> summoning external emergency assistance . <br /> The following information must be posted next to the telephone (or other <br /> emergency communication device) : <br /> • The name and telephone number of the emergency coordinator; <br /> • The location of fire extinguishers and spill control material, and fire <br /> alarm; and <br /> • The telephone number of the fire department, unless the facility has a <br /> direct alarm . <br /> 6. 4. EMERGENCY RESPONSE EQUIPMENT <br /> The facility must have the following emergency response equipment onsite <br /> and easily accessible : <br /> • Internal and external communication equipment <br /> • Fire control equipment <br /> • Water supply with adequate volume and pressure for fire suppression <br /> • Spill control equipment <br /> • Decontamination equipment <br /> • Personal protective equipment <br /> CGA 25 MAY 2015 <br />
